The impact you will have: You are passionate about leading change and building relationships Youu2019re a dynamic professional who prides yourself on building and fostering meaningful partnerships that fuel growth and drive mutual success. As the Partner Alliance Manager (PAM), you will be responsible for developing and managing our alliance for a portfolio of partners, including strategy, Go-To-Market (GTM) plans, sales team alignment, enablement planning, and execution. The PAMu2019s responsibility will be to develop and drive the execution of revenue-driving programs and initiatives, and to evangelize Softchoiceu2019s value proposition for partners within Softchoice. The key to the position is strong collaboration with multiple cross-functional stakeholders, including sales, services, product management, marketing, and operations. You will establish trusted business relationships with senior leaders at our partners and act as the day-to-day primary interface. You will develop and take accountability for the local relationships in your region, which include campaign activities, joint investment programs, Partner local alignment efforts, and enablement plans. Build a growing and profitable partner practice that results in high levels of product and service sales within your region by developing strategic plans. What you'll do: u2022 Work with GTM, Sales, Services, Operations, and Marketing personnel (including leadership) within Softchoice and our Partners to create a joint strategy that includes investments in Practice Development, co-selling initiatives, marketing development funds, and Sales enablement programs u2022 Work with the Partner Alliance and Demand Generation teams to execute plans in all supported/targeted regions, developing region-specific plans, driving partner revenue growth, and delivering customer success. u2022 Build strategic plans around our security partners' investments, which will help Softchoice achieve field margin and profitability targets u2022 Incorporate security partnersu2019 sales plays, offerings, and industry assets/solutions to specific markets for local execution and engagement with our field sales team in alignment with Softchoice priorities. u2022 Deliver key performance metrics and revenue reporting tied to strategies and initiatives in close alignment with internal and external stakeholders. u2022 Review sales play metrics/effectiveness on a recurring basis with partners, Softchoice Sales & Business Development teams. u2022 Communications - Ensure effective and timely internal & external communication and coordination of execution results. u2022 Evangelize the security value proposition through enablement programs, which you will co-develop. u2022 Inform which investments are needed to drive transformational change at Softchoice. u2022 Create and execute vendor sales incentive programs to support strategic initiatives, including contest design, communication, and reporting. u2022 Act as an expert on leveraging partner programs to develop pricing strategies and maximize profitability. u2022 Build and conduct quarterly business reviews with partners and Softchoice key stakeholders. u2022 Own the design, logistics, and content for partner visits, conferences, and partner-driven customer events. u2022 Initiate account mapping and partner field relationships every month with key markets and report back wins. Compensation: A reasonable estimate of the current base pay range for this position in Chicago, McLean, Dallas is $72,000 u2013 $90,000 annually + 20% as target incentives. Boston is $87,360 u2013 $109,200 annually + 20% as target incentives. Seattle is $88,000 u2013 $110,000 annually + 20% as target incentives. Actual salary will be based on a variety of factors, including location, experience, skill set, education, and related certification. The range for this position in other geographic locations may differ.
